Can't the NFL ban it even if it is legal? What is the rule on this in Colorado? Can any employer still make tests mandatory, and make testing positive a fireable offense?

Yup, they can. It's all in the CBA. Josh Gordon can't have an alcoholic drink.

 

But for what it's worth, pot will likely be removed from tested substances soon. The players will just have to negotiate it and probably give in on other PED testing.

Exactly Ryan. For example, our sales reps in CO cannot smoke weed and work at our company and we drug test. It doesn't matter the State law, because first there is a federal law against it, and second, the NFL is his employer and are legally able to enforce their policies.

 

Nothing will change until the Feds change the law legalizing marijuana which won't happen. It will keep going state by state possibly a change in medical marijuana, but that is going to take years.

 

The sad thing is they are only tested if not in the program typically once to twice a year usually in the Spring. These idiots don't know it stays in your hair for about 35 days. If they simply cleaned up every spring during March and April until maybe tested in May, they'd never get caught. Once you fail a test they can test you 10x / mo.
